The Impact of Feminism in Economics—Beyond the Pale? A Discussion and Survey Results

Pages 253-273 | Published online: 10 Jul 2014
 

Abstract

Although the number of women studying economics has increased, survey results are used to argue that feminism has had little impact on scholarship in economics. The reasons for this lack of impact are explored and analyzed.
